My mother has back pain for 2 weeks and her test for Dengue Antigen IgG was positive but IgM was negative and NS1 Antigen negative.Is she having a dengue infection? She has no other symptoms of dengue.

Hi dear if the IgG is positive but the IgM is low or negative, then it is likely that the person had an infection sometime in the past. You can easily take an online consultation for further treatment guidance
